Early Learning Playscape at Naper Settlement
The Early Learning Playscape at Naper Settlement is a fort-themed playground and splash pad featuring a replica covered wagon, trading post, animal track path, and sensory prairie garden. Naperville's settlers built the original fort during the Blackhawk War of 1832 as a temporary shelter for their small community.

Sunny Hill Park Splash Pad
This park features endless amounts of fun with a 9-hole disc golf course, tennis courts, a basketball court, a skate/BMX park, two playgrounds, a seasonal splash pad, and a seasonal sled hill. The splash pad consists of multiple spray devices for water play with little to no standing water.
